Ferries from Salerno (All Ports) to Capri run year-round from Salerno ports, 7 days a week. The first ferry from the Salerno port departs at 08:25, and the last at 08:25 from Salerno. From June to September, there are approximately 7 crossings per week. In quieter periods, the route is served by around 3 crossings per week. The fastest ferry departing from Salerno, takes 1h 30min, while on average the ferry trip lasts about 1h 30min. Ticket prices range from €30.50 to €33.00. Can you bring a car on the ferry from Salerno (All Ports) to Capri?

Ferries from Salerno (All Ports) to Capri don’t carry vehicles. Only foot passengers are permitted.

Cabins on board

Cabins are not available on the ferries from Salerno (All Ports) to Capri. However, comfortable lounge seating or designated rest areas are provided for you to relax in during your trip.

Bringing your pet on the ferry

Pets are welcome on ferries between Salerno (All Ports) and Capri, but rules differ by company. General guidelines:

  • Pets over 10 kg go in onboard kennels, while smaller ones (under 10 kg) can travel in a pet carrier.
  • Service dogs are not subject to kennel rules.
  • Bring all needed documents and pet supplies.

Getting to the ferry ports in Salerno (All Ports)

To get to the Salerno ports, head to the ferry terminal located near the city center at Piazza della Concordia, just a short walk from popular areas like the Lungomare promenade. If you’re coming from Salerno's train station, you can easily reach the terminal by foot in about 20 minutes, or take a local bus or taxi for a quicker option. For those arriving by car, there is parking available nearby, but it can fill up quickly during peak seasons.

From Naples International Airport, you can take a bus directly to Salerno, which takes about 1.5 hours. Alternatively, consider catching a train from Naples to Salerno for a scenic journey that lasts around an hour.

Once in Capri, the ferry terminal is located at Marina Grande. This terminal is easily accessible and just a short stroll from the main piazza and popular attractions like the funicular to Anacapri.
